COLUMBIA, Md.—The Foundation Fighting Blindness has added Jeff Klaas, a seasoned health care and technology nonprofit leader, to its team as chief strategy and innovation officer. Klaas joins the Foundation Fighting Blindness with a distinguished career that spans over 25 years in senior executive global management roles. He brings a wealth of experience and a track record in driving strategies and fostering innovation across a spectrum of industries. Throughout his career, Klaas has held pivotal roles in prominent organizations such as the American Cancer Society, where he served as the executive vice president and chief digital officer.

While at the American Cancer Society, he led multiple teams contributing to $700 million in annual revenue, emphasizing results-driven initiatives connecting technology to patient outcomes.

His entrepreneurial journey is exemplified by having co-founded and served as the chief executive officer of International Audio Visual, Inc., where he successfully navigated the company through capitalization strategies and a strategic transition to a private equity group buyout. A distinguished academic, Klaas serves as a professor in innovation, entrepreneurship and social good at the University of California San Diego.

"We are thrilled to have Jeff Klaas join our executive leadership team at the Foundation Fighting Blindness," said chief executive officer, Jason Menzo. "His extensive experience, entrepreneurship mindset, and passion for technology and philanthropy perfectly complement our team. His proven ability to deliver revenue growth will play a pivotal role in advancing our mission toward treatments and cures for blinding diseases."

In this newly created role, Klaas will steer the Foundation Fighting Blindness toward strategies, innovation and partnerships that drive revenue, programs and solutions aimed at driving the research for treatments and cures for blinding diseases. He will oversee the departments of development, community engagement, chapters, events and marketing and communications.

"I am deeply honored to be a part of the Foundation Fighting Blindness, an organization at the forefront of research for blinding diseases," said Klaas. "This opportunity not only reflects my professional journey but also allows me the opportunity to address the challenges my family and others face by blinding retinal diseases."
